Wollombi Valley will be transformed for 16 days during the staging of the annual Sculpture in the Vineyards Festival that runs from October 26 until November 10.

On display and for sale is $1.3 million worth of sculpture with 41 indoor and 52 large outdoor sculptures by award winning artists from all over Australia making the 2019 event the biggest in the festival's 17 year history.
There is more than $32,000 in prizemoney.
Paul Selwood a local Wollombi sculptor who has won Sculpture by the Sea has entered a sculpture in the Wollombi Valley Sculpture festival for the first time in 15 years. He is impressed by the size and depth of this year's Festival and is very proud to be associated with it.
Armando Percuoco - celebrity chef, art patron, collector and an original sponsor of Sculpture by the Sea is one of this year's judges. He is also is very excited by and impressed by the standard of art that will on display and for sale in the Wollombi Valley.
Other award Winning Sculptors from all over Australia include:
Vince Vozzo, Peter Lundberg, Stephen Coburn, Peter Tilley, Robert Barnstone, Hugh McLachlan, Fiona Kemp, Jane Dawson
Sculptures will be on display and for sale at the GNTP Laguna, Undercliff Winery, Endeavour Museum Wollombi, Grays Inn, Stonehurst Winery, Wollombi Tavern, The Old Fireshed Gallery, St Johns Church and many public spaces throughout the valley.
